Specialized

Relating to or characterized by a particular activity, skill, or subject; designed for or used for a specific purpose or task. It implies a focused area of expertise, knowledge, or training, often distinguishing it from broader, more general applications. This can involve intricate knowledge, advanced techniques, or dedicated equipment, tailored to address specific needs within a defined field.
